About Patrick Charmley

Patrick Charmley is a scholar working on Immunology, Molecular Biology, Genetics, Pathology and Forensic Medicine and Oncology, having authored 46 papers that have together received 1.7k indexed citations. Recurring topics across this work include T-cell and B-cell Immunology (23 papers), Immune Cell Function and Interaction (15 papers), Immunotherapy and Immune Responses (6 papers), DNA Repair Mechanisms (4 papers), Monoclonal and Polyclonal Antibodies Research (4 papers), Immunodeficiency and Autoimmune Disorders (4 papers), CAR-T cell therapy research (4 papers) and T-cell and Retrovirus Studies (3 papers). The work is most often cited by research in Immunology (678 citations), Orthopedics and Sports Medicine (157 citations), Genetics (336 citations), Oncology (301 citations) and Pathology and Forensic Medicine (169 citations). Patrick Charmley has collaborated with scholars based in United States, Netherlands and South Africa. Frequent co-authors include Patrick Concannon, Wei Shan, Richard A. Gatti, L Hood, Mary Ann Robinson, Sean Proll, Mary E. Brunkow, Bryan Paeper, Randall C. Schatzman and Steven S. Beall. Their work appears in journals such as Immunogenetics, Genomics, Nucleic Acids Research, The Journal of Immunology and Annals of the New York Academy of Sciences.
